Small Planet Airlines chooses FL Technics for wheel & break support

Small Planet Airlines chooses FL Technics for wheel & break support FL Technics, a global provider of one-stop-shop aircraft maintenance, repair and overhaul services, continues increasing its presence in the components support market. The European MRO has recently signed a brand new brake and wheel maintenance contract with Small Planet Airlines, a leisure carrier with an all-Airbus fleet of 18 aircraft.

According to the freshly inked 3-year contract, FL Technics shall support the carrier’s Airbus A320 fleet under the charge-per-aircraft-landing programme. The agreement covers component supply, repair and overhaul in Small Planet Airlines’ bases across the UK, France, Italy, Germany, Cambodia, Poland and Lithuania as well as in all of its future locations. The latest partnership is an extension of the previous cooperation between the parties in the field of component supply and maintenance management. The companies initially started working on joint projects back in 2013.

FL Technics provides its clients with comprehensive component maintenance services using its own 30 000 sq. m. fully equipped hangars and workshops in Vilnius, Kaunas and Jakarta as well as its extensive partner network across the UK, Germany, Vietnam and other countries around the globe.
